Name | 1-Chlorooctane |
---|---|
Synonym | More Synonyms |
Density | 0.9±0.1 g/cm3 |
---|---|
Boiling Point | 181.9±3.0 °C at 760 mmHg |
Melting Point | −61 °C(lit.) |
Molecular Formula | C8H17Cl |
Molecular Weight | 148.674 |
Flash Point | 57.8±0.0 °C |
Exact Mass | 148.101883 |
LogP | 4.69 |
Vapour Pressure | 1.1±0.3 mmHg at 25°C |
Index of Refraction | 1.425 |
Storage condition | 2-8°C |
Water Solubility | 0.02 g/L |
